Norse Traditions
Younger Futhark and the Test of Fate
The Younger Futhark contains sixteen runes, each serving as a sign of speech, fate, force, and transformation.
Odin’s search for wisdom, sacrifice, and rune-knowledge reveals that power must be tested by will, suffering, and fate before it becomes true insight.

India & Hinduism
Shodashi, Sixteen Kalas and the Soul’s Rites
The Shodasha Kalas, or sixteen rays or phases, symbolize fullness of consciousness, often linked to the moon’s completeness.
Shodashi, the sixteen-year-old goddess and form of Tripura Sundari, embodies perfect beauty, realization, and the splendor of consciousness made whole.
The sixteen samskaras mark the soul’s journey through birth, learning, responsibility, marriage, death, and liberation.

Buddhism
Sixteen Arhats and Disciplined Awareness
The Sixteen Arhats are guardians of the Dharma, exemplars of awakened discipline, wisdom, and compassionate preservation of the teaching.
Sixteen meditative or contemplative stages are also used in some Buddhist analytical frameworks, symbolizing the refinement of awareness toward liberation.

Japan, Shintō & Buddhism
The Chrysanthemum and Jūroku Rakan
The sixteen-petal chrysanthemum is the Imperial Seal of Japan, symbolizing solar authority, divine rule, renewal, and radiance.
The Jūroku Rakan, or Sixteen Arhats, are revered in temples as exemplars of awakened compassion and perfected service.

Judaism
Omer Awakening and Measured Progression
The sixteenth of Nisan begins the Counting of the Omer, a sacred forty-nine-day journey of purification from Passover toward Shavuot.
Kabbalistic texts interpret this measured ascent as refinement of the soul through divine attributes, judgment, mercy, balance, and unity.

Islam
Surah an-Naḥl and Divine Provision
Surah 16, an-Naḥl, “The Bee,” speaks of divine provision, creation, balance, gratitude, and signs in nature.
The bee gathers nectar and produces honey, symbolizing the harmonious order of divine law manifest in creation and the healing wisdom hidden in the natural world.

Africa
Sixteen Primordials and the Sixteen Odù
Dogon cosmology speaks of primordial beings and archetypal structures through which creation unfolds, law emerges, and cosmic order becomes intelligible.
Yorùbá Ifá divination is founded upon sixteen principal Odù, each a spiritual archetype and guide of destiny.
